| <?php | |
| /* | |
| * This code uses the original function and | |
| * adds a shortcode functionality to display the product loop with | |
| * the products that are available adding also another shortcode for | |
| * products that are unavailable | |
| * | |
| * Usage: [bookable_products start="2019-10-10" end="2019-10-15"] | |
| * [unbookable_products start="2019-10-10" end="2019-10-15"] | |
| * | |
| * This was meant to use with Accomodation bookings, which work in day blocks. | |
| * Modification may be needed to search for hour blocks | |
| * | |
| * Add this code to the functions.php file of your theme folder | |
| * | |
| */ | |
| function checkBookableRooms($bookStart,$bookEnd){ | |
| /** | |
| * WooCommerce Bookings Availability Search | |
| * | |
| * This is almost pseudo code, it only serves to explain the "how to do it" and does not attempt to be "The Way" to do it. | |
| * NOTE: This NEEDS to be refined in order to work as expected. | |
| * | |
| * @author António Pinto <apinto@vanguardly.com> | |
| * @license http://opensource.org/licenses/gpl-license.php GNU Public License | |
| * | |
| * @var string $bookStart (example: '2016-06-14 16:23:00') | |
| * @var string $bookEnd (example: '2016-06-14 16:23:00') | |
| */ | |
| // Creating DateTime() objects from the input data. | |
| $dateTimeStart = new DateTime($bookStart); | |
| $dateTimeEnd = new DateTime($bookEnd); | |
| // Get all Bookings in Range | |
| $bookings = WC_Bookings_Controller::get_bookings_in_date_range( | |
| $dateTimeStart->getTimestamp(), | |
| $dateTimeEnd->getTimestamp(), | |
| '', | |
| false | |
| ); | |
| // Build Array of all the Booked Products for the given Date-Time interval. | |
| $exclude[] = 0; | |
| foreach ($bookings as $booking) { | |
| $exclude[] = $booking->product_id; | |
| } | |
| // Do a regular WP_Query using 'post__not_in' with the previous array. | |
| $args = array ( | |
| 'post__not_in' => $exclude, | |
| 'post_type' => ['product'], | |
| 'post_status' => ['published'], | |
| ); | |
| return $args; | |
| } | |
| function getProducts( $atts ) { | |
| $startDate = date(strtotime($atts["start"]),"Y-m-d")." 00:00:00"; | |
| $endDate = date(strtotime($atts["end"]) ,"Y-m-d")." 23:59:59"; | |
| $wpArgs=checkBookableRooms($startDate,$endDate); | |
| $latest = new WP_Query($wpArgs); | |
| $post_ids = wp_list_pluck( $latest->posts, 'ID' ); | |
| return do_shortcode("[products ids='".implode(",", $post_ids)."']"); | |
| } | |
| add_shortcode( 'bookable_products', 'getProducts' ); | |

Hi, I tried to use the code and I got error: date() expects parameter 2 to be int. referring to this part:
$startDate = date(strtotime($atts["start"]),"Y-m-d");
$endDate = date(strtotime($atts["end"]) ,"Y-m-d");
Can you help me fix it?
Oh wow, didn't notice that. I'll try to fix it ASAP.
The fix is simple, puth the "Y-m-d" BEFORE the comma and the strtotime bit after the comma.

Saved me a right nightmare of trying to find the relevant code in their plugin. Only update needed now is changing "WC_Bookings_Controller" to "WC_Booking_Data_Store"
